  1. 1 Whether the accused committed theft by servant under sections 271 and 265 of the Penal Code
  2. 2 Whether the prosecution proved its case beyond reasonable doubt
  3. 3 Whether the accused's actions constituted a criminal offence given the procedures at the Party Headquarters

Ratio Decidendi

The prosecution failed to prove beyond reasonable doubt that the accused stole the books or proceeds; the accused acted openly, used official documents, and accounted for the proceeds as permitted by the Party's fluid procedures.

Court Disposition

appeal allowed

Orders

  • conviction and sentence quashed and set aside
  • accused to be released from prison unless otherwise lawfully held
